Coaching news 

This week I had Ian in for a lesson where we worked on extension of the arms through the hitting area and maintain his height through the swing. In the picture with the arrow pointing down you can see the left arm giving way as well as his height whilst attacking the golf ball. 

 

I got Ian to stand on the bench at the practise area and make a few swings to feel his left arm straightening when making a swing. This you can see in the picture with the upward facing arrow.

Extension of the arms is key in ball striking consistency, direction and power. Next time you're practising at the practise area stand on the bench and make a few swings. Make sure you maintain your balance though. You may however get a few strange looks by fellow members playing the course.

Did you get the answer to last week's rule? 

Q. Gordon and Bob are playing a Jubilee Bowl Tie. On the 2nd hole Bob used a wooden tee to mark the position of his ball on the green. When Gordon played his chip shot onto the green it was deflected by Bob tee. What's the ruling?

Answer
A. There is no penalty and Gordon needs to play his next shot as it lies. Gordon should have requested Bob to move the tee to the side or substitute the tee for a smaller marker. Rule 20-1. Decision- 20-1/17.
